Xperia Z, Lineage OS - How to have ext4 formatted external sd card?

silverbluep

Member
Dec 13, 2017
34
7
0
I want to have ext4 formatted external sd card. My card is gpt formatted (tried with msdos too) to a ext4 partition, but im getting the 'this device doesnt support this sd card' warning, and asking to format the card. If i format it works fine, but as fat32. Any way I can fix this? This was the major point for me; to move to a fs with permissions.
 

Zerikwan

Senior Member
May 11, 2016
556
203
53
Pekanbaru
There is a way to format it through TWRP, but I never try it except for cache and system. You can try it and tell me, because I don't have a spare external micro SD card to try.
But remember, I'm just telling you the way. You are responsible for your sd card.

Wipe - advanced wipe - check "micro SD card" checkbox then repair or change file system - change file system - choose EXT4


BTW, my external sd card format is shown as vfat.
 
Last edited:

silverbluep

Member
Dec 13, 2017
34
7
0
Will try this once i back it up; but it shouldnt be much different than doing it on the pc with gparted.

Vfat is the same with fat32 from whata i understand. At least mkfs with fat32 makes a vfat partition from my linux knowledge.

On my main phone, i formatted to ext4 and it worked fine (LOS 15.1 pioneer) but permission wise i still can't grant permissions (chmod doesnt change anything; i still iont get this whole cluster**** about sd cards and permissions) so i guess it doesnt help me either way. I could possibly fix problems by symlinking, but that is not allowed on the sd card uven when its ext4 (cannot create symlink using adb shell, phone wont let me ?)